Special emphasis in 2014 will be on food processing and converting/package printing. In 2013, the food production sector experienced the fastest growth in Russia. The per capita consumption of foodstuffs increased by almost 12% in 2011 and is expected to continue at an average rate of 11% yearly until 2015. Another promising sector is printed packaging with 5% to 6% annual growth. 2012 also marked impressive growth rates in the manufacturing of high quality flexible and cardboard packaging.
Russia is one of the most lucrative markets for the consumer goods industry. The Russian Federation with its approximately 143 million inhabitants is among the leading sales markets for the food, beverage, cosmetics and pharmaceutical industries. The growing middle class and increasing prosperity have resulted in a change of consumer and shopping behavior. There is an increased interest in new and modern processed and packaged food and beverages and this development drives the Russian packaging industry and the demand for innovative machinery, materials and technologies.
